The idea has its roots back in the 1980s, when environmentalists began persuading Western banks to write off some Latin American debt in return for those countries agreeing to preserve tracts of rainforest, in what became known as debt-for-nature swaps.
Debt2Health is similar to debt-for-nature swaps, in which rich countries write off a poor country's debt in exchange for commitments that money which is freed up will be spent on environmental protection.
Debt conversion, debt-for real-estate swaps, debt-for-development swaps, debt-for-nature swaps, and debt prepayment: the creditor exchanges the debt claim for something of economic value on the same debtor.
